主题中讨论的其他器件: 测试2、 CC1101
我们是一家英国以外的数据公司、使用利用 RF 传输的数据收集设备。 该设备是一个仪器化的接口,它使用 ST 电子低功耗收发器组件传输数据。 在使用过程中、此射频传输信号由插入附近 PC 的接收器捕获。
此设置已通过 FCC 和 CE 认证、但需要注意的是、在合规性测试期间、必须根据 FCC 法规扩大频段:
|
CE |
FCC |
基频 |
868 MHz |
921 MHz |
频率偏差 |
20 kHz |
229 kHz |
通道带宽 |
100 kHz |
541 kHz |
过去、我们采用的是 RX 端的 ST 芯片、但现在我们已经转而采用由德州仪器提供的 CC430F5137。
使用我们的 CE 设置、转换是无缝的、并且性能几乎与使用 ST 芯片实现的结果相同。 但是、在美国、我们使用 FCC 设置、产品可以工作的范围大大减少。 下表显示了这一点。
|
CE |
FCC |
ST 芯片 |
100M 范围 |
100M 范围 |
TI 芯片 |
100M 范围 |
5m 范围 |
上次我问到这个问题时、有人告诉我 SmartRF Studio。
下表包含了我们的 CE 寄存器设置(良好范围)、我们的 FCC 寄存器设置(错误范围)以及 FCC 的 RF Studio 建议设置。
寄存器设置 |
CE 设置 |
FCC 设置 |
RF Studio FCC |
IOCFG1 |
0x09 |
0x09 |
0x09 |
IOCFG0 |
0x06 |
0x06 |
0x06 |
PKTLEN |
0x3D |
0x3D |
0x3D |
PKTCTRL1 |
0x06 |
0x06 |
0x06 |
PKTCTRL0 |
0x05 |
0x05 |
0x05 |
地址 |
0x01 |
0x01 |
0xAA |
CHANNR |
0x01 |
0x02 |
0x02 |
FSCRTL1 |
0x0C |
0x0C |
0x0C |
频率 Q2 |
0x21 |
0x23 |
0x23 |
频率 Q1 |
0x62 |
0x6C |
0x6C |
频率0 |
0x76 |
0x4E |
0x4E |
MDMCFG4 |
0xCA |
0x2A |
0x2A |
MDMCFG3 |
0x83 |
0x83 |
0x83 |
MDMCFG2 |
0x13 |
0x13 |
0x13 |
DEVIATN |
0x35 |
0x71 |
0x71 |
MCSM0 |
0x10 |
0x10 |
0x10 |
F0CCFG |
0x16 |
0x16 |
0x16 |
AGCCTRL2 |
0x43 |
0x43 |
0x43 |
工作控制 |
0xF0 |
0xF0 |
0xFB |
介绍3 |
0xE9 |
0xE9 |
0xE9 |
FSCAL2 |
0x2A |
0x2A |
0x2A |
FSCAL1 |
0x00 |
0x00 |
0x00 |
FSCAL0 |
0x1F |
0x1F |
0x1F |
测试2 |
0x81 |
0x81 |
0x81 |
测试1 |
0x35 |
0x35 |
0x35 |
测试0 |
0x09 |
0x09 |
0x09 |
BSCFG |
0x6C |
0x6C |
不存在 |
MCSM1 |
0x30 |
0x30 |
不存在 |
FSTEST |
0x59 |
0x59 |
不存在 |
F1F0THR |
0x07 |
0x07 |
不存在 |
IOCFG2寄存器 |
0x29 |
0x29 |
不存在 |
FREND1 |
0x56 |
0x56 |
不存在 |
FREND0 |
0x10 |
0x10 |
不存在 |
AGCCTRL1 |
0x40 |
0x40 |
不存在 |
AGCCTRL0 |
0x91 |
0x91 |
不存在 |
MDMCFG1 |
0x22 |
0x22 |
不存在 |
MDMCFG0 |
0xF8 |
0xF8 |
不存在 |
FSCTRL1 |
0x08 |
0x0C |
不存在 |
FSCTRL0 |
0x00 |
0x00 |
不存在 |
从这些设置中、我看不到任何会导致性能降低的东西。